Pulaski Memorial Hospital is a medicare enrolled primary clinic (General Practice) in Knox, Indiana. The current practice location for Pulaski Memorial Hospital is 2 S Pearl St, Knox, Indiana. For appointments, you can reach them via phone at (574) 207-5050. The mailing address for Pulaski Memorial Hospital is Po Box 279, Winamac, Indiana and phone number is (574) 946-2100.

Pulaski Memorial Hospital is licensed to practice in * (Not Available) (license number ). The clinic also participates in the medicare program and its NPI number is 1528626652. This medical practice accepts medicare insurance (which means this clinic accepts the Medicare-approved amount; you will not be billed for any more than the Medicare deductible and coinsurance). As Obama takes oath again, health law's fate rest with others

Obamacare is going into effect next year for real -; but what happens with President Barack Obama's signature achievement in his second term is largely out of his hands. The biggest piece of the law -; the expansion of coverage to as many as 30 million uninsured Americans -; will begin in 2014. Obama may not say a word about that in his inaugural address.
